PART NUMBER: VWRBT2 Series  
DESCRIPTION: dc-dc converter  
description  
features  
Designed to convert a wide input  
voltage range into an isolated  
regulated voltage, the  
VWRBT2-SMT series is well  
suited for providing board-mount  
local supplies in a wide range of  
applications, including mixed  
analog/digital circuits, test &  
measurement equip.,  
·wide (2:1) input range  
·regulated  
·single voltage output  
·I/O isolation: 1500 V dc  
·no heatsink required  
·short circuit protection  
·MTBF >1,000,000 hours  
·temperature range: -40°C~+85°C  
process/machine controls,  
datacom/telecom fields, etc...

In order to ensure the product operates  
efficiently and reliably, make sure the specified range  
of input voltage is not exceeded.  
- Recommended circuit  
No parallel connection or plug and play.  
It is best to test with full load and not to test without load. To  
further reduce output ripple, you may increase the external  
capacitor, choose a capacitor with low ESR, or add external  
inductor to the circuit as shown above.  
- NC Terminals  
Unless otherwise specified, NC terminals of all series  
are used for converter's interior circuit  
connection, and are not allowed connection of any  
external circuit.
